43. BUYING HORSES FOR THE CONTINENTAL ARMY Partly-printed D.S., 1p. 4to., Lancaster Co., Pa., Sep. 4, 1780, a "Pennsylvania" bond for the purchase of a horse for the use of the Continental Army. Payment is made for: "...one Bay horse 4 yrs old, fourteen hands high for the wagon...", and appraised in value by "two Freeholders, on Affirmation..." Typical numerous ink notations, with endorsements on verso, with the right edge border design bearing the word "PENNSYLVANIA" in block letters. An important bond providing for horses for the Continental Army. $500-600
